Artwork Format & Quality
To get the best results, we recommend providing high-resolution artwork (300dpi), ideally as a .png with a transparent background. We also accept .jpg, .pdf, .ai, .eps, and .psd files. Avoid large blocks of solid colour, which can produce slight banding during the inkjet printing process. Flatten or outline text to prevent compatibility issues.
Please note: We cannot guarantee exact Pantone colour matching, especially when printing on kraft or manila materials, where the natural background may influence the final result.
White & Metallic Printing
We do not print with white ink, so any white areas in your artwork will appear as the natural colour of the material. Metallic colours (e.g., gold, silver) will be printed as high-quality flat colour equivalents. Embossing and foiling are not available, as our inkjet printing system is designed for speed and flexibility.

Tolerances & Quality Expectations
Due to the nature of printing on pre-made packaging, small shifts in artwork placement may occur. Product dimensions may vary by up to 20mm, which is considered standard in the packaging industry. Slight imperfections or colour variations, especially on kraft materials, are to be expected and fall within acceptable tolerances.
